Entry requirements

Entry requirements for this course are normally:

  • An Honours degree (2:2 or above) in Electrical Engineering, Control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Systems Engineering or similar, or in a closely related science subject area such as physics or mathematics or an equivalent professional qualification.

You are also encouraged to apply if you have other qualifications and/or experience and can demonstrate that you are equipped with knowledge and skills equivalent to Honours degree level.

If your first language is not English, you will need to meet the minimum requirements of an English Language qualification. The minimum for IELTS is 6.0 overall with no element lower than 5.5, or equivalent. Course content

Looking to start or develop your career in the engineering management sector? An MSc in Engineering Management from The University of Huddersfield can help you with that.

Designed to meet the industry demand for management focused engineers, our course aims to deepen your knowledge and skills in engineering, technology and applied science. You’ll also gain the confidence and competencies to excel in a senior management position.

As a graduate from our programme, look forward to developing your abilities and skills so you can step into roles not only in engineering or technical management, but also in general management in a wide range of sectors.
